What is the largest 4-digit number that has both 25 and 30 as factors.

To begin, we know that 9000 will be a four-digit number that has both 25 and 30 as factors, since 9 is divisible by 3, and the number has a final two digits that are divisible by 25 (an even hundred). However, this is not the largest four-digit number. We can do the same with 9900, since 99 is a multiple of 3, as well, and is still a round-hundred. We know that 9925, 9950, and 9975 are not divisible by 30 evenly, so the largest four-digit number divisible by 25 and 30 is 9900.
